"At first glance Toile Blanche, in the French Riviera town of Saint-Paul-de-Vence, appears to be an absolutely classic farmhouse hotel; renovated, certainly, but timeless in its appeal. Like so many others, it’s family-owned and -operated, but in this case the family in question is Nicolas, Gilles, and Gregory Leroy, a trio of “Post-Internet” artists operating as the Leroy Brothers collective. And Toile Blanche isn’t just a farmhouse-style luxury boutique hotel displaying a vast selection of their work, though it’s certainly that — it’s also a carefully curated experience in its own right, every detail chosen with the utmost care." - Tablet Hotels
